Output 04f586bd6787bc327405376a18fc640125cb10d54f6582f223407fda1d37b658:1

value
16910288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2faa7f4a86826663f0921bceefe1ff4052093542 OP_EQUAL
address
3633vv2YTNktdfLMR4SQBmwgqFbwuvXDQa
transaction
04f586bd6787bc327405376a18fc640125cb10d54f6582f223407fda1d37b658
spent
true